Household of James Castel (born 1823, Aberdeenshire)

1881 England, Wales & Scotland Census in Ythan Wells, Aberdeenshire, Scotland

The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of James Castel, born in 1823 in Fyvie, Aberdeenshire, consisted of 3 members. James was the head of the household, married to Margaret Castel, born in 1818 in Banffshire, Scotland. They had 1 child; George, born 1857 in Forgue, Aberdeenshire, Scotland.
